1. Water Conservation and Reclamation Technology
The average craft brewery uses 4 to 7 barrels of water to produce just one barrel of beer. Reducing this Water-to-Beer (W:B) ratio is the single most impactful sustainability measure a brewery can take. Effective water management involves more than just fixing leaks; it requires investment in advanced reclamation systems.
Key Steps for Water Optimization:
- Condensate Capture: Install systems to capture and repurpose steam condensate from the kettle boil. This water is already clean and hot, making it ideal for the next brew cycle or cleaning operations, drastically reducing natural gas use for reheating.
- Reverse Osmosis (RO) Reject Water Usage: Instead of dumping RO reject water, redirect it for cooling towers, cleaning operations, or landscaping.
- Dry Cleaning Protocols: Prioritize scraping and sweeping spent grain and hops before rinsing tanks. This prevents solid matter from entering the wastewater stream, reducing biological oxygen demand (BOD) and subsequent treatment costs.
- Implement High-Efficiency CIP: Upgrade Clean-In-Place (CIP) systems to use less water per cycle while maintaining cleaning efficacy, often through better spray ball design and flow dynamics.
2. Spent Grain Upcycling and Waste Diversion
Spent grain accounts for over 85% of a brewery’s solid waste. While traditional disposal involves selling or donating to local farms for feed, leading-edge breweries are maximizing value by upcycling this material into human-grade consumables, opening entirely new revenue streams.
Maximizing Spent Grain Value:
Instead of just viewing spent grain as a liability, see it as a nutrient-rich byproduct. Innovative technologies allow breweries to dry and mill spent grain into high-protein, high-fiber flour used in baking, pasta, and even energy bars. This shift transforms a disposal cost into a product line, enhancing the brewery’s circular economy model. Furthermore, meticulous sorting of solid waste (spent yeast, trub, and packaging) ensures that less than 5% of production waste ends up in landfills.
3. Energy Efficiency Audits and Renewable Integration
Energy consumption—primarily heating mash, boiling wort, and running refrigeration units—is the second largest operational expense after raw materials. Simply switching to LED lighting is entry-level; true efficiency comes from systemic process improvements and the integration of renewable energy.
Actionable Energy Strategy:
- Professional Energy Audit: Hire a specialist to audit your utilities, focusing specifically on boiler efficiency, compressed air leaks, and chiller performance. These audits often reveal opportunities for 10-20% immediate savings.
- Heat Recovery Systems: Install sophisticated systems to recover heat generated during wort cooling (used to pre-heat brewing water) and from the refrigeration compressors (used to heat water for cleaning).
- On-Site Renewables: Where space allows, investing in solar thermal or photovoltaic panels provides a hedge against volatile utility prices. Many municipalities offer incentives that significantly reduce the payback period for these installations.
4. Optimized Packaging and Lightweighting
The environmental footprint of your product doesn’t end when the liquid is canned or bottled; packaging choices dramatically impact transportation efficiency and end-of-life recycling. The focus here is on reducing material usage without compromising product integrity or brand aesthetic.
Sustainable Packaging Focus:
- Material Choice: While both glass and aluminum are recyclable, aluminum generally has a higher recycled content rate and is significantly lighter. Lightweighting—using slightly thinner glass or aluminum—reduces raw material demand and cuts shipping fuel consumption.
- Eliminate Excess: Minimize secondary packaging, such as plastic wraps or excess cardboard carriers. Use recycled and recyclable materials for all labels and box construction.

5. Local Sourcing and Supply Chain Transparency
Reducing the distance ingredients travel directly cuts fossil fuel consumption and carbon emissions. Sourcing locally is not just an environmental benefit; it’s a powerful marketing tool that connects your product deeply to its region.
Building a Localized Supply Chain:
- Grain and Hops: Prioritize working with local farms or regional maltsters. While sometimes costlier upfront, reduced transit costs and fresher ingredients often balance the investment.
- Transportation Efficiency: Beyond ingredients, look at how your finished product moves. Consolidating shipments and using efficient distribution networks minimizes miles traveled. 6. Carbon Capture and Footprint Reduction
Fermentation naturally produces significant amounts of CO2. For larger breweries, capturing and reusing this CO2 is a powerful initiative that eliminates the need to purchase external, often fossil fuel-derived, CO2 for carbonation and packaging.
Implementing CO2 Reuse:
- Small-Scale Capture: Even if full industrial capture is not feasible, smaller breweries can invest in membrane separation technologies that capture fermentation CO2 for direct use in the cellar, offsetting purchasing needs.
- Carbon Offsetting Programs: For breweries where on-site capture is impractical, invest in credible, certified carbon offset programs (e.g., local reforestation, methane capture projects). Ensure these programs are verifiable and relevant to the beverage industry’s impact.
Reducing your carbon footprint is essential for long-term climate resilience and compliance with potential future carbon taxes or pricing schemes.
7. Closed-Loop Cleaning Systems (CIP Recovery)
Chemical usage and disposal are major environmental concerns in brewing. Caustic and acid solutions used in Clean-In-Place (CIP) systems are powerful and, when improperly managed, contribute to severe wastewater challenges. Closed-loop recovery systems ensure these valuable chemicals are filtered and reused effectively.
Optimizing Chemical Use:
- Caustic Recovery Units: Install systems that filter out soils and solids from used caustic solutions, allowing the solution to be re-titrated and reused for multiple cycles. This significantly reduces chemical purchasing costs and drastically lowers the alkalinity load on wastewater treatment plants.
- Smart Dosing: Utilize automated dosing equipment to ensure chemicals are used only at the necessary concentrations, minimizing waste and ensuring optimal cleaning efficacy every time.
